Transaction 75eecaba534faf47e093b8940b9ba564e7fa29e42f46f89b9ee5694cc2fc8eb1

1 Input
2 Outputs
  • 75eecaba534faf47e093b8940b9ba564e7fa29e42f46f89b9ee5694cc2fc8eb1:0
  • value  10895715
    address  36MHyEzYFuQEU641exJADb1x7sa8TXsS84
  • 75eecaba534faf47e093b8940b9ba564e7fa29e42f46f89b9ee5694cc2fc8eb1:1
  • value  269956357
    address  3MXWKnt6CRXRHcVm2fyLq4SdG2FQpDPUux